There's a lot more to the cost of insurance than you guys are stating. There's a huge difference between $50k per person/$150k per accident coverage and $100k per person/$300k per accident coverage. What is your property damage coverage? Do you carry uninsured motorist insurance and at what level? What are your deductibles for collision and comprehensive? All these things matter a lot. Merely saying you pay $1200 a year tells nothing about what you are paying for. Just my $.02.
